
Freight billing errors are far more common than most businesses realize, and the financial impact adds up quickly when invoices go unchecked. Studies across the logistics industry consistently show that between 3% and 10% of all carrier invoices contain some form of overcharge, duplicate fee, or miscalculated accessorial. For small and medium-sized businesses shipping LTL freight in Ontario and Quebec, that margin of error can translate into thousands of dollars lost per year without a single red flag. The challenge is that these errors rarely announce themselves, which is exactly why a disciplined freight audit process separates businesses that control costs from those that quietly bleed margin on every shipment cycle.
Most freight billing errors are not the result of carrier fraud or intentional overcharging. They stem from systemic issues: misapplied tariffs, incorrect weight classifications, and accessorial charges that were never agreed upon. Understanding where these mistakes originate is the first step toward building a freight cost audit process that actually catches them before payment goes out.
The most frequent freight audit failures fall into predictable categories. Businesses that ship regularly, especially via LTL, encounter these issues on a recurring basis. Here are the errors that show up most often during carrier billing audits:
Duplicate invoicing: Carriers sometimes generate two invoices for the same shipment due to system errors or re-billing after corrections, and both get paid if nobody checks.
Incorrect freight class: NMFC classifications directly affect pricing, and even a single digit misclassification can inflate a shipment's cost by 15% or more.
Unapproved accessorial charges: Fees for liftgate service, inside delivery, or residential delivery often appear on invoices even when those services were not requested or used.
Weight discrepancies: Carriers may re-weigh shipments at origin or destination, and the adjusted weight does not always match the actual load, resulting in inflated charges.
Rate mismatches: Contracted rates sometimes fail to carry over into a carrier's billing system, causing invoices to reflect standard tariff pricing rather than negotiated rate structures.
Performing a freight invoice audit once a quarter, or only when a charge looks obviously wrong, creates a false sense of cost control. Billing errors are distributed randomly across shipments, which means a spot-check approach will miss the majority of them. When businesses let weeks of invoices accumulate without review, the window for filing disputes with carriers often closes. Most carriers impose a 30 to 90 day limit on billing corrections, and once that window passes, the overcharge becomes a permanent cost. The businesses that recover the most from freight invoice auditing are those that build it into their weekly or bi-weekly workflow rather than treating it as an occasional cleanup task.

Knowing the common errors is only useful if a business has a repeatable system to catch them. The difference between recovering thousands per year and letting that money slip through comes down to process design: who reviews invoices, what they compare them against, and how quickly disputes get filed.
Businesses shipping fewer than 50 loads per month can often manage freight rate audits internally, provided they assign a specific person to the task and give them access to rate confirmations, BOLs, and carrier contracts. The review should compare every invoice line item against the original quote and the bill of lading. Any discrepancy in weight, class, accessorial fees, or base rate should trigger a dispute before the carrier's correction window closes.
For businesses with higher volume or limited internal resources, third-party freight audit and payment services handle the entire review cycle. These providers use automated matching engines that flag discrepancies at scale, often catching errors that manual review would miss. The trade-off is cost: most audit services charge a percentage of recovered savings or a flat monthly fee. For companies shipping across Ontario and Quebec, the math tends to favor outsourcing once monthly freight spend exceeds $15,000 to $20,000, because the error recovery at that volume typically outpaces the service cost by a wide margin. A detailed freight audit checklist can help businesses standardize their review process regardless of which approach they choose.
One of the most effective ways to reduce freight billing errors is to eliminate the conditions that create them. Traditional freight booking through phone calls and email chains introduces manual data entry at every step, and each touchpoint is an opportunity for a rate, weight, or service level to be recorded incorrectly. Digital freight platforms address this by locking in quoted rates, service details, and shipment specifications at the point of booking. When the quote, the booking confirmation, and the invoice all pull from the same data source, the most common sources of discrepancy disappear before the shipment even moves. Truxweb, for example, consolidates quoting, booking, and payment into a single platform where the rate a shipper sees at quote time is the rate that appears on the final invoice, reducing the need for post-delivery audits on LTL shipments across Canada.
Catching billing errors after they occur is necessary, but the highest-performing shipping operations focus on prevention. Every step between quote request and final payment offers an opportunity to lock down accuracy, and the businesses that treat freight cost reduction as a process rather than a one-time audit tend to maintain tighter margins over time.
The majority of freight charge verification failures trace back to inaccurate shipment data entered at the point of origin. When a shipper submits an incorrect weight, wrong commodity description, or inaccurate pallet count, the carrier's invoice will reflect the corrected data at pickup or delivery, not what was originally quoted. This gap between quoted and actual charges is the single largest driver of invoice disputes in LTL freight. Businesses can close this gap by implementing standard operating procedures for shipment data entry. That means weighing every pallet before booking, verifying NMFC codes against actual product specifications, and confirming delivery requirements such as liftgate or appointment scheduling before the carrier dispatches. These steps take minutes per shipment but prevent the kinds of errors that generate unexpected charges worth hundreds of dollars each.
Truxweb's platform supports this by requiring shippers to enter detailed shipment specifications during the quoting process, which carriers then use to generate accurate rate responses. When both sides work from the same verified data, the rate on the freight quote closely matches the rate on the final invoice.
Beyond individual invoice errors, businesses should track accessorial charges over time to identify patterns. If a specific carrier consistently adds fuel surcharges above the contractual rate, or if residential delivery fees appear on shipments going to commercial addresses, those are not random mistakes. They are systemic issues that a one-time audit will catch once but that will continue occurring on future shipments unless addressed directly with the carrier. Building a simple spreadsheet or using your TMS to log every accessorial charge by carrier, lane, and type creates visibility into hidden costs that impact shipping budgets. Over a 90-day period, this data reveals which carriers bill cleanly and which require closer scrutiny on every invoice.
Businesses that combine proactive data standardization with regular audit cycles and carrier performance tracking create a closed loop where errors are caught quickly and their root causes are addressed permanently. That combination, rather than any single audit, is what produces meaningful freight cost reduction year over year. Understanding what goes into freight pricing gives logistics managers the context they need to question every line item with confidence. Knowing where businesses commonly overspend on freight shipping provides an additional lens for prioritizing audit efforts. The question of whether to handle audits internally or outsource freight auditing depends on shipment volume, internal bandwidth, and how much spend is at risk each month.
Freight billing errors are not edge cases; they are a predictable, recurring cost that compounds with every shipment cycle left unchecked. The businesses that recover the most are those that treat freight invoice auditing as a structured, ongoing process rather than an occasional review. By standardizing shipment data at the point of booking, auditing invoices weekly, and tracking accessorial charge patterns by carrier and lane, any business shipping LTL freight in Canada can reclaim thousands of dollars in annual overpayments. The tools and platforms exist to make this manageable even for small teams.
Start comparing transparent carrier rates and reduce billing discrepancies at the source with Truxweb.
A freight audit is the process of reviewing carrier invoices against original rate agreements, bills of lading, and shipment details to identify billing errors, duplicate charges, and unauthorized fees before or after payment.
Freight invoices should be audited weekly or bi-weekly to stay within carrier dispute windows and catch errors before they become permanent costs.
Hidden freight charges include unapproved accessorials such as liftgate fees, residential delivery surcharges, re-delivery fees, and fuel surcharge overages that appear on invoices without being part of the original quote.
For businesses spending more than $15,000 per month on freight, third-party audit services typically recover more in billing errors than they charge in fees, making them a net-positive investment.
Compare every invoice line item against the original rate confirmation and bill of lading, checking for weight discrepancies, freight class mismatches, rate deviations, duplicate invoices, and unauthorized accessorial charges.